161 Duration displaying body JP23401590 1990-09-04 JPH04113295A 1992-04-14 MITSUMA TOSHIO; NOGUCHI HIROO; YAMAMOTO WATARU
PURPOSE: To simplify starting operation of duration display by folding and holding a bellows part in the vicinity of an open end of main vessel in which a substance to be dyed is stored, by closing off a hole provided to a sub-vessel which seals and stored, dyeing substance at a place lower than the bellows part, and by fixing together the main and sub-vessels at their top ends. CONSTITUTION: The duration displaying body of this invention consists of a cylindrical main vessel 2 storing a substance to be dyed, and a cylindrical sub- vessel 3 which is inserted and engaged into an open end of the main vessel 2, and stores and seals a dyeing substance. In the vicinity of the open end of main vessel 2, a bellows part 6 is folded and held, and a hole 4,4' provided to the sub-vessel 3 is closed off by a barrel wall 5 placed below the bellow part 6. The main vessel 2 and the sub-vessel 3 are fixed together at their top ends. When in use, the bellows part 6 of the main vessel 2 is extended, then the hole 4,4' is released for the dyeing substance to proceed to the side of substance to be dyed and therewith display of duration is commenced by contact of the both substances. 167 Device for indicating elapsed time JP23977888 1988-09-27 JPH0288992A 1990-03-29 MINOWA SHIYUUJI
PURPOSE: To allow the easy recognition of the lapse of time from a change in color by housing the laminate of a volatile liquid holding layer which contains a volatile liquid to exhibit high light transparency into a container having a freely openable/closable aperture and evaporating the liquid. CONSTITUTION: This device is constituted of the laminate 3 formed by laminating the volatile liquid holding layer 2 on an opaque base layer, the aperture 4 which evaporates the volatile liquid from the volatile liquid holding layer 2 at the controlled speed and a door 5 for starting the evaporation of the volatile liquid. This volatile liquid holding layer 2 has the property to irregularly reflect at least the external light on the surface thereof at the time of the layer 2 not contain volatile liquid and has the property that the transparency of light increases and the color of the opaque base layer 1 is visible at least partly through this layer once the volatile liquid holding layer contains liquid. A user is allowed to visually recognize the lapse of the time from the start of the evaporation of the volatile liquid on the volatile liquid holding layer 2 before the volatile liquid is substantially absent (dried) in the volatile liquid holding layer 2 as a change in the color of the indicating surface. 168 Period lapse display body JP5329788 1988-03-07 JPH01250090A 1989-10-05 MATSUDAIRA OSAHISA; KAWAMOTO KENJI; KOBAYASHI MASAYOSHI; YASUDA KOICHI
PURPOSE: To provide the period lapse display body which is capable of indicating the period to about one year by adding a diffusion delaying agent which is hardly affected by light, humidity, etc., and delays the diffusion of a dyeing material into an agar gel. CONSTITUTION: A sealing material 3 of the agar gel added with carrageenin as the diffusion delaying agent is packed into a body 1 and a basic dye 4 for coloring the sealing material 3 is packed into a cap body 2. A user starts display by cutting the body 1 at a cutting line 6, removing the hermetic cap of the cap body 2 and coupling both at the time of starting the period display. The dyeing material 4 of the cap body 2 diffuses into the sealing material of the body 1 and the body 1 appears as if said body is colored successively and therefore, the termination of the period is displayed from the degree of the progression of the coloring. 171 Medicinal effect indicator JP30724087 1987-12-04 JPH01148990A 1989-06-12 MATSUDAIRA OSAHISA; KAWAMOTO KENJI; KOBAYASHI MASAYOSHI; YASUDA KOICHI
PURPOSE: To accurately judge the presence of the effective component of a drug by direct visual observation, by judging the presence of the medicinal effect component by the display of the dye directly reacting with the volatile medicinal effect component to discolor. CONSTITUTION: The presence of a medicinal effect component is judged by the display of the dye directly reacting the volatile medicinal effective component to discolor and, when a drug is volatilized and the medicinal effect component is lost, the dye returns to the initial hue and the exhaustion of medicinal effect can be confirmed. That is, an oxidation inhibitor, an alkaline substance and the dye reversibly changing a color through the reaction with the volatile drug are allowed to coexist and, if necessary, an ultraviolet absorber is added to the base material. As the volatile drug, there is an org. phosphorus insecticide such as Acephate and, as the dye, there is a titration indicator such as alizarin red S. The alkaline substance is added to these substances to make the indicator acidic near to neutral before use. With respect to oxygen in air, a reducing agent such as monophenol is used as the oxidation inhibitor and, with respect to ultraviolet rays, an ultraviolet ray cutting filter is used or the ultraviolet absorber such as phenylsalicylate is used. 172 Device for indicating lapse of time JP30175387 1987-11-30 JPH01141974A 1989-06-02 YASUDA KOICHI; KAWAMOTO KENJI; KOBAYASHI MASAYOSHI; MATSUDAIRA OSAHISA
PURPOSE: To obtain the title device which can be corrected in a decrease in the moving speed of a dyeing substance during its diffusion, by localizing a specified dyeing substance in part of a highly viscous liquid or a gel-like substance having a concentration gradient and packed in a container. CONSTITUTION: The body 1 which is a transparent or light-color container (e.g., PE tube) through the wall of which the contents can be seen from the outside is filled with a developing medium 3 which is a highly viscous liquid or a gel-like substance (e.g., agar) having a concentration gradient equivalent to the reciprocal of the diffusion equation of the formula [wherein J is the diffusion rate (mol./cm 2), D is the diffusion coefficient (cm 2/sec), C is the concentration (mol./cm 2), and X is the distance (cm)]. Separately, a cover 2 is filled with a dyeing substance 4 (e.g., aqueous solution of Methylene Blue) which can color or discolor the developing medium 3. After the body 1 is cut along a dotted line 6 and the sealing cap 5 is removed from the cover 2, the body 1 is combined with the cover 2 at the start of indication of the period of time in order to indicate the term of validity of a product such as an insecticide, a fragrance or a deodorant, whereupon the dyeing substance 4 diffuses into the developing medium 3 with the laps of time.
